Dothan vs Fort Collins

Fair Market Rent Comparison — HUD 2025 Data

Quick Answer

Dothan is 90% cheaper for renters. A 2-bedroom rents for $647/mo vs $1,227/mo in Fort Collins — saving $6,960/year.

Rent by Unit Size

Unit SizeDothanFort CollinsDifference
Studio$422$839$417
1 Bedroom$540$990$450
2 Bedrooms$647$1,227$580
3 Bedrooms$786$1,487$701
4 Bedrooms$991$1,747$756
Median Income$39,179$63,053$23,874
